On April 13, 2023, D.R.N. HOUSING CORP. (the 'Landlord') applied
for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ict N.I. (the 'Tenant') and for an order to have
the Tenant pay the rent they owe because the Tenant did not meet a condition specified in the
order issued by the LTB on March 30, 2023 with respect to application LTB-L-003911-23.
This application was decided without a hearing being held.
Determinations:
1. The order provides that the Landlord can apply to the LTB under section 78 of the
Residential Tenancies Act, 2006 (the 'Act') without notice to the Tenant to terminate the
tenancy and evict the Tenant if the Tenant does not meet certain condition(s) in the order.
This application was filed within 30 days of the breach.
2. I find that the Tenant has not met the following condition specified in the order: The Tenant
failed to pay the lawful monthly rent in full on or before April 1, 2023.
3. The previous application includes a request for an order for the payment of arrears of rent
and the order requires the Tenant to make payments by specific due dates. Accordingly, in
addition to eviction, the Landlord is entitled to request an order for the payment of arrears
owing.

4. The Tenant was required to pay $876.00 for rent arrears and the application filing fee in the
previous order. The amount that is still owing from that order is $876.00 and that amount is
included in this order.
5. Since the date of the previous order, the Tenant has failed to pay the full rent that became
owing for the period from April 1, 2023 to April 30, 2023.

6. The Landlord is entitled to daily compensation from the day after this order is issued to the
date the Tenant moves out of the unit at a daily rate of $8.22. This amount is calculated as
follows: $250.00 x 12, divided by 365 days.
It is ordered that:
1. Order LTB-L-003911-23 is cancelled.
2. The tenancy between the Landlord and the Tenant is terminated. The Tenant must move
out of the rental unit on or before May 27, 2023.
3. If the unit is not vacated on or before May 27, 2023, then starting May 28, 2023, the
Landlord may file this order with the Court Enforcement Office (Sheriff) so that the eviction
may be enforced.
4. Upon receipt of this order, the Court Enforcement Office (Sheriff) is directed to give vacant
possession of the unit to the Landlord on or after May 28, 2023.
5. The Tenant shall pay to the Landlord $1,081.52* (Less any payments made by the
Tenant after this application was filed on April 13, 2023). This amount represents the
rent owing up to May 16, 2023 and the cost of filing the previous application.
6. The Tenant shall also pay to the Landlord $8.22 per day for compensation for the use of
the unit starting May 17, 2023 to the date the Tenant moves out of the unit.
7. If the Tenant does not pay the Landlord the full amount owing on or before May 27, 2023,
the Tenant will start to owe interest. This will be a simple interest calculated from May 28,
2023 at 6.00% annually on the balance outstanding.
